CSD LAB’s Head of Development and Innovation spoke about development and challenges of PTSD

A veteran commits suicide every 65 minutes in America. One of the key reasons is PTSD. What will happen to Ukrainian veterans, and whether we will face similar disappointing statistics, depends on the ability to identify PTSD and its treatment. Viktor Dosenko, professor at the Bogomolets Institute of Physiology, head of the development and innovation department at CSD LAB medical laboratory, pathophysiologist, MD, told Interfax-Ukraine about the peculiarities of diagnosis, course and prospects for treatment of PTSD.

– Currently, Ukraine is just beginning to study the issue of PTSD. How relevant is this problem for Ukraine? When will we face the manifestations of PTSD, when will its impact be visible?

– Both extremes – that everyone has PTSD, or that there is no PTSD – certainly do not correspond to the real state of affairs, do not correspond to scientific data, and have negative consequences. How should the scientific and medical community approach this issue? In a balanced, logical, scientific way: Not everyone will have PTSD, of course, and not everyone has it, not even half of the population. Many military men do not have any PTSD. But at the same time, the number of people with PTSD in Ukraine is quite large – unfortunately, we do not have a register of patients with this pathology, so there are no exact figures.

To detect PTSD in a person, there is a screening. In particular, CSD LAB has taken a serious interest in this problem and has a separate section on the medical laboratory’s website where anyone can take a screening test for PTSD. Because in order to treat, you need to identify the patients. The task of finding such people is not an easy one. No one will come to the hospital and say: “I have PTSD, treat me”. A person may not know about his or her condition.

I want to note that the world celebrates the International PTSD Screening Day every year. Currently, the problem of diagnosis is relevant all over the world, because it occurs not only in countries where there are hostilities. Many other factors can also lead to the development of this serious mental illness. The earlier we detect this disease, the better and more effective the therapy will be. Therefore, screening programs to detect PTSD are currently being practiced around the world. In particular, experts from the US National Center for PTSD Research have developed the so-called five questions of perception. If a person gives a positive answer to at least three of them, this does not mean that he or she has PTSD, but it does mean that he or she needs to see a specialist.

– Can we say that PTSD is a mental illness, or is it just a situational problem of a spoiled mood?

– It is a mental illness. In the international classification of diseases, it is classified as a mental health disorder. The diagnosis of PTSD is made by a psychiatrist.

– But in practice, as psychiatrists say, a person with mental health problems usually believes that everything is fine, it’s just that the world around them is different. How do you get a person to pay attention to their condition and start treatment?

– A person needs to take a test and answer these five questions of perception. Our task now is to bring this information to the public. This is a free, evidence-based and very accurate way of screening. Not diagnosis, but screening, which, if necessary, will refer a person to a specialist for treatment.

PTSD is a serious problem. According to statistics from the U.S. Department of Veterans Affairs, a veteran commits suicide every 65 minutes in America. Healthy men who have returned from serving in the U.S. military, with all the support programs and rehabilitation centers, face this problem. We are not saying that all veterans in the United States have PTSD and are suicidal, but if we compare veterans with other men, the presence of PTSD increases the likelihood of suicide six times. For women, this figure is even higher. This is terrible data and, unfortunately, there is no reason to think that it will be any different in Ukraine.

– What is the root cause of PTSD?

– There are two factors that trigger the development of PTSD. The first is direct contact with death. Not on television, not in photos, not in telegram channels, but direct, visual contact with death. A person sees death, and it strikes at what is called the core of the personality, at their own beliefs about what is good and what is evil. The second factor that can trigger PTSD is indirect contact with death, even without contact. These are two established factors. Everything else is a risk factor that increases the probability. That is, a person with existing mental illness is more likely to have PTSD. People who have used or are using drugs have a higher probability. People who have weak social support, no family, no children, or a traumatic personal life are more likely to have PTSD. Of course, there is also a genetic predisposition. But these are not causes, they are factors that increase the probability.

– How does PTSD differ from other reactions to a stressful situation?

– The fact that this horror of contact with death stays in the brain, in the psyche. It does not leave a person, and they keep returning to the traumatic situation. This event already exists exclusively in memories, it is detached from life, it has nothing to do with the current situation, but it is imprinted in the psyche and begins to dominate consciousness. The situation that caused PTSD has already happened, it does not repeat itself, and the person is still in it. This makes PTSD very different from other diseases, including chronic stress.

PTSD leads to hormonal disruptions. To a certain extent, PTSD is a neurohumoral disease. When the hormonal background changes, when stress is “lame” by one hormone. What this means is that under stress, the level of both adrenaline and cortisol in the blood should increase. But in PTSD, only the level of adrenaline rises, and cortisol is even lower than in healthy people. It’s like stress, but inferior – adrenaline dominates, and there is no cortisol, which should provide negative feedback and stop the stress response.

– And how does this threaten the human body?

– This is fraught with the fact that the body does not receive communication. Cortisol is supposed to come to the brain after stress and trigger recovery mechanisms. But there is no cortisol, the brain believes that the order to mobilize has not been fulfilled, so it gives commands to produce adrenaline and a stress response again and again. This exhausts the body. In medicine, this is called a “vicious circle,” from which the psyche cannot break free on its own.

– Are there any medications being developed for PTSD?

– Currently, there are only two antidepressants that have been proven to work and improve the condition. Other drugs are being studied. There are quite a few of them, so we expect that new drugs will appear and be researched. In particular, medicines based on medical cannabis and psychotropic drugs. But, unfortunately, Ukraine is currently outside of these studies not only because of the war, but also because it is forbidden to study these drugs in Ukraine.

– In the USSR and in all post-Soviet countries, unfortunately, this diagnosis was ignored. In Ukraine, there used to be no legal definition of PTSD. In this aspect, the question was not raised at all. That is, if a person had the consequences of a military injury or contusion, they could be offered treatment and rehabilitation in a sanatorium, and restored in neurological terms. Psychiatry and psychological assistance were out of the question. Currently, we also do not see work with those who may have suffered from PTSD 30 years ago. Only now have we begun to pay attention to these people. The first diagnoses of PTSD appeared in America in the 80s of the last century, and for quite a long time in other countries, even in Europe, it was believed that it was not a disease. That is, it took decades for PTSD to be accepted. Now it is necessary to develop diagnostic criteria and to communicate these criteria to doctors.

– Can PTSD be cured, or is it a chronic disease that stays with a person for life?

– PTSD is treatable, of course! In half of the cases, it will go away on its own. But this information is dangerous, because people will think that they don’t need to see a doctor, they say, PTSD will go away on its own. This is a mistake! You need to see a doctor to treat PTSD. In half of the people, PTSD can go away on its own, and in half of them it will not. And no one knows which half a person belongs to. PTSD is perfectly treated with psychotherapy, of course, if you start in time and if there are qualified specialists. In some cases, pharmacotherapy is required. Is it possible to catch cold in summer?

What a question – of course, because there are characteristic “aggravating” summer factors, when the heat is replaced by a cool breeze or air conditioning, when you want water from the refrigerator (or not water, but ice cream :)), and no one has canceled the classic pathogens of SARS.

But there is something else that mimics the common cold.
It looks like a stuffy nose and rhinitis that occur in late summer. There may be itchy eyes or watery eyes, a sore throat, subfebrile fever, loss of concentration, and sometimes a dry, hacking cough. It sounds like a cold, doesn’t it?
But the symptoms last for several weeks or more. A person goes to the doctor and may hear that they need to be tested for… allergies.

August and September are characterized by pollinating weeds. There are many of them, but we usually hear about ragweed and wormwood most often (and for good reason, because they are classic representatives of the class).

You can see these representatives not only in the countryside, but also on city roadsides. Sensitized people experience allergy symptoms during their pollination, and sometimes cross-reactivity symptoms in the form of allergic reactions to certain foods (for example, sunflower seeds, watermelon, melon, and grapes, which are also in season now).

What should I do if I experience the above symptoms?
Of course, consult a doctor who will conduct an examination and prescribe additional tests to confirm the diagnosis.

If you notice the same symptoms for several years in a row and/or suspect a pollen allergy, ask your doctor what tests you should take.

Improving effectiveness of therapy and personalized medicine in Ukraine: pharmacogenetics tools and new direction of diagnostics from CSD LAB

It has long been known that the body’s response to various drugs, and thus the effectiveness of treatment, depends on the metabolic characteristics of each individual. But the study of genetic factors that affect chemical transformations in the body began only in the 20th century.
The paradigm of “treating the patient, not the disease” resulted in the concept of “personalized medicine”. The essence of personalized medicine is the individualization of drug therapy. The response to a drug, the optimal class of drug, its dose and mode of administration are determined, at least in part, by genetic determinants. Pharmacogenetics seeks to identify genes and their variants that determine the adequacy of pharmacotherapy and reduce the risk of side effects.

For a modern doctor, pharmacogenetics is a convenient and affordable tool to increase the effectiveness of evidence-based therapy for many diseases and, at the same time, reduce the likelihood of side effects. For a patient, pharmacogenetics means confidence that the drug prescribed by a doctor will act reliably and predictably, and will show maximum therapeutic effectiveness.

What needs to be done for this? Investigate the genetic information of a particular person regarding the genes that affect drug transport.

The test determines sensitivity to warfarin by detecting CYP2C9*2, CYP2C9*3 and VKORC1 G1639A mutations in human genomic DNA by real-time PCR.
The most common complication of warfarin therapy is bleeding, the risk of which can be reduced by 35%, and taking into account other factors (patient weight, prescription of other medications, etc.) – by 50%.
Warfarin is used for the treatment and prevention of deep vein thrombosis and pulmonary embolism, for the secondary prevention of myocardial infarction and prevention of thromboembolic complications (stroke or systemic embolism) after myocardial infarction, for the prevention of thromboembolic complications in patients with atrial fibrillation, heart disease or prosthetic heart valves, prevention of dynamic cerebrovascular disorders and stroke, and prevention of postoperative thrombosis.

This genetic test will allow you to determine the variations of the CYP2C19 gene (CYP2C19*2, CYP2C19*3 CYP2C19*17).
CYP2C19 is a clinically important enzyme involved in the biotransformation of a number of antidepressants, anticoagulants, and antimycotic drugs. For example, clopidogrel is a very effective antiplatelet drug whose action is based on irreversible inhibition of the platelet receptor P2RY12. However, in some patients, the therapeutic effect of the drug does not manifest itself, which is why it is necessary to change the drug, losing time in the patient’s treatment.
Why does this happen? The answer is simple: clopidogrel is a prodrug, which is activated by the cytochrome P450 complex, mainly CYP2C19. With a certain gene variant, this does not happen and the effectiveness of the drug is significantly reduced. In this case, you should choose another antiplatelet drug.
